Zoning, Drinking Water Well, Septic Tank (or other sanitary waste treatment system), Burning, Electri- cal, Plumbing, Heating and Air Conditioning, In- sulation and Energy Conservation, FIA Certifica- tion, Sand Dune, Sediment Control, Subdivision Approval, Mobile Home Park Approval, Highway Connection, Others: c rp APPLICATION FOIZ D APR o 6 'g CAMA � MINOR DEVELOPMENT PERMIT In 1974, the North Carolina General Assembly passed the Coastal Area Management Act and set the stage for guiding development in the fragile and productive areas which border the state's sounds and oceanfront. Along with requiring special care by those who build and develop, the General Assembly directed the Coastal Resources Commission (CRC) to implement clear regula- tions which minimize the burden on the applicant. This application for a minor development permit under CAMA is part of the Commission's effort to meet the spirit and intent of the General Assembly. It has been designed to be straightforward and require no more -.time or effort necessary from the applicant. Please go over. this folder with the Local Permit Officer (L.PO) for the locality in which you plan to build to be certain that f ' 1 you understand what information he or she needs. `Under LAMA regulations, the minor permit is to be issued within 25 days once a complete application is in I hand. Often less time is needed if the project is simple. The process generally takes about 18 days. You can, speed the approval process by making certain that your application is complete and signed, that your drawing meets the specifications given inside and that your application fee is attached. Box 1679 Morehead City NC 28557 NOTICE OF FILING OF APPLICA7701'V FOR CAMA MINOR DEVELOPMENT PERMIT Pursuant to NCGS 113A-119(b), Pine Knoll Shores, a locality authorized to issue CAMA permits in Areas of Environmental Concern, hereby gives NOTICE that on 4/4/95, Thomas Simpson, agent for Odell Thompson, applied for a CAMA permit for land disturbing activity associated with installation of rip rap within the Estaurine Shoreline AEC, at 262 Oakleaf Drive, Pine Knoll Shores, NC. The application may be inspected at the address below. Public comments received by 4/17/95 will be considered. Later comments will be accepted and considered up to the time of permit decision. Project modifications may occur based on further review and comments. Notice of the permit decision in this matter will be provided upon written request. Roy D.
